kopia lustrzana https://github.com/wagtail/wagtail
Merge pull request #1768 from annp89/feature/improve_exception_handling
Use model specific "DoesNotExist" exceptionpull/1771/head
commit
6afc3a9ead
|
@ -10,7 +10,7 @@ from taggit.managers import TaggableManager
|
||||||
from willow.image import Image as WillowImage
|
from willow.image import Image as WillowImage
|
||||||
|
|
||||||
from django.core.files import File
|
from django.core.files import File
|
||||||
from django.core.exceptions import ImproperlyConfigured, ObjectDoesNotExist
|
from django.core.exceptions import ImproperlyConfigured
|
||||||
from django.db import models
|
from django.db import models
|
||||||
from django.db.models.signals import pre_delete, pre_save
|
from django.db.models.signals import pre_delete, pre_save
|
||||||
from django.dispatch.dispatcher import receiver
|
from django.dispatch.dispatcher import receiver
|
||||||
|
@ -223,7 +223,7 @@ class AbstractImage(models.Model, TagSearchable):
|
||||||
filter=filter,
|
filter=filter,
|
||||||
focal_point_key=cache_key,
|
focal_point_key=cache_key,
|
||||||
)
|
)
|
||||||
except ObjectDoesNotExist:
|
except Rendition.DoesNotExist:
|
||||||
# Generate the rendition image
|
# Generate the rendition image
|
||||||
generated_image, output_format = filter.run(self, BytesIO())
|
generated_image, output_format = filter.run(self, BytesIO())
|
||||||
|
|
||||||
|
|
Ładowanie…
Reference in New Issue